Lines Matching defs:resp

175 	CB_GETATTR4res *resp = &resop->nfs_cb_resop4_u.opcbgetattr;
195 *cs->statusp = resp->status = cb4_getattr_fail;
200 resp->obj_attributes.attrmask = 0;
210 *cs->statusp = resp->status = NFS4ERR_BADHANDLE;
238 *cs->statusp = resp->status = NFS4ERR_BADHANDLE;
287 *cs->statusp = resp->status = NFS4ERR_BADHANDLE;
302 fap = &resp->obj_attributes;
372 *cs->statusp = resp->status = NFS4_OK;
388 CB_RECALL4res *resp = &resop->nfs_cb_resop4_u.opcbrecall;
405 *cs->statusp = resp->status = cb4_recall_fail;
418 *cs->statusp = resp->status = NFS4ERR_BADHANDLE;
478 *cs->statusp = resp->status = NFS4ERR_BAD_STATEID;
486 *cs->statusp = resp->status = 0;
510 cb_null(CB_COMPOUND4args *args, CB_COMPOUND4res *resp, struct svc_req *req,
541 CB_ILLEGAL4res *resp = &resop->nfs_cb_resop4_u.opcbillegal;
545 *cs->statusp = resp->status = NFS4ERR_OP_ILLEGAL;
549 cb_compound(CB_COMPOUND4args *args, CB_COMPOUND4res *resp, struct svc_req *req,
559 cs.statusp = &resp->status;
565 resp->tag.utf8string_len = args->tag.utf8string_len;
566 resp->tag.utf8string_val = kmem_alloc(resp->tag.utf8string_len,
568 bcopy(args->tag.utf8string_val, resp->tag.utf8string_val,
575 resp->array_len = 0;
576 resp->array = NULL;
577 resp->status = NFS4ERR_MINOR_VERS_MISMATCH;
595 resp->array_len = args->array_len;
596 resp->array = kmem_zalloc(args->array_len * sizeof (nfs_cb_resop4),
602 resop = &resp->array[i];
644 bcopy(resp->array,
646 kmem_free(resp->array,
649 resp->array_len = i + 1;
650 resp->array = new_res;
657 cb_compound_free(CB_COMPOUND4res *resp)
662 if (resp->tag.utf8string_val) {
663 UTF8STRING_FREE(resp->tag)
666 for (i = 0; i < resp->array_len; i++) {
668 resop = &resp->array[i];
688 if (resp->array != NULL) {
689 kmem_free(resp->array,
690 resp->array_len * sizeof (nfs_cb_resop4));